开发者社区> 问答> 正文

如何从 ArrayList 中删除重复项?

Java中的ArrayList 中删除重复项?请举例

展开
收起
YDYK 2020-04-24 17:09:45 414 0
1 条回答
写回答
取消 提交回答
  • 有两种方法可以从 ArrayList 中删除重复项。

    使用哈希集:通过使用 HashSet,我们可以从 ArrayList 中删除重复的元素,但之后不会保留插入顺序。 使用链接哈希集:我们还可以使用链接哈希集而不是哈希集来维护插入顺序。 使用链接哈希集从 ArrayList 中删除重复元素的过程:

    将 ArrayList 的所有元素复制到链接哈希集。 使用 clear() 方法清空 ArrayList,该方法将从列表中删除所有元素。 现在,将 LinkedHashset 的所有元素复制到 ArrayList。

    2020-04-24 17:09:57
    赞同 展开评论 打赏
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载